The `.uninit` linker section can be used to leave `static mut` variables uninitialized. One use +//! case of unitialized static variables is to avoid zeroing large statically allocated buffers (say +//! to be used as thread stacks) -- this can considerably reduce initialization time on devices that +//! operate at low frequencies. +//! +//! The only correct way to use this section is by placing `static mut` variables with type +//! [`MaybeUninit`] in it. +//! +//! [`MaybeUninit`]: https://doc.rust-lang.org/core/mem/union.MaybeUninit.html +//! +//! ``` ignore +//! use core::mem::MaybeUninit; +//! +//! const STACK_SIZE: usize = 8 * 1024; +//! const NTHREADS: usize = 4; +//! +//! #[link_section = ".uninit.STACKS"] +//! static mut STACKS: MaybeUninit<[[u8; STACK_SIZE]; NTHREADS]> = MaybeUninit::uninit(); +//! ``` +//! +//! Be very careful with the `link_section` attribute because it's easy to misuse in ways that cause +//! undefined behavior. At some point in the future we may add an attribute to safely place static +//! variables in this section. // # Developer notes // |
